Bill Text: TX HB2763 | 2017-2018 | 85th Legislature | Comm Sub
Bill Title: Relating to solid waste services and solid waste management programs in the extraterritorial jurisdiction of municipalities in certain counties; authorizing penalties.
Spectrum: Partisan Bill (Democrat 1-0)
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2017-05-09 - Laid on the table subject to call [HB2763 Detail]

relating to solid waste services and solid waste management | ||
programs in the extraterritorial jurisdiction of municipalities in | ||
certain counties; authorizing penalties. | ||
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: | ||
SECTION 1. Section 364.011, Health and Safety Code, is | ||
amended by adding Subsection (a-1) to read as follows: | ||
(a-1) Notwithstanding Subsection (a), a commissioners court | ||
may, through a competitive bidding process, contract for the | ||
provision of solid waste collection, handling, storage, and | ||
disposal in an area of the county located within the | ||
extraterritorial jurisdiction of a municipality if: | ||
(1) the municipality does not provide solid waste | ||
disposal services in that area; and | ||
(2) the county has a population of more than 1.5 | ||
million and at least 75 percent of the population resides in a | ||
single municipality. | ||
SECTION 2. Section 364.034, Health and Safety Code, is | ||
amended by amending Subsection (a) and adding Subsections (a-1) and | ||
(a-2) to read as follows: | ||
(a) A public agency or a county may: | ||
(1) offer solid waste disposal service to persons in | ||
its territory, including, in the case of a county described by | ||
Section 364.011(a-1)(2), an area of the county located within the | ||
extraterritorial jurisdiction of a municipality if the | ||
municipality does not provide solid waste disposal services in that | ||
area; | ||
(2) require the use of the service by those persons, | ||
except as provided by Subsection (a-1); | ||
(3) charge fees for the service; and | ||
(4) establish the service as a utility separate from | ||
other utilities in its territory. | ||
(a-1) Notwithstanding Subsection (a)(2), a person is not | ||
required to use solid waste disposal services offered by a county to | ||
persons in an area of the county located within the | ||
extraterritorial jurisdiction of a municipality that does not | ||
provide solid waste disposal services in that area if: | ||
(1) the person contracts for solid waste disposal | ||
services with a provider that meets rules adopted by the commission | ||
for the regulation of solid waste disposal; or | ||
(2) the person is a private entity that contracts to | ||
provide temporary solid waste disposal services to a construction | ||
site or project by furnishing a roll-off container used to | ||
transport construction waste or demolition debris to a facility for | ||
disposal or recycling. | ||
(a-2) Subsection (a-1) does not affect the authority of a | ||
governmental entity to pursue actions under Subchapter B, Chapter | ||
365, to address illegal dumping. | ||
SECTION 3. Subchapter C, Chapter 364, Health and Safety | ||
Code, is amended by adding Section 364.0345 to read as follows: | ||
Sec. 364.0345. PENALTIES FOR FAILURE TO USE REQUIRED | ||
SERVICE IN CERTAIN AREAS. The commissioners court of a county | ||
described by Section 364.011(a-1)(2) that requires the use of a | ||
county solid waste disposal service under Section 364.034 in the | ||
extraterritorial jurisdiction of a municipality may adopt orders to | ||
enforce the requirement, including an order establishing a civil or | ||
administrative penalty in an amount reasonable and necessary to | ||
ensure compliance with the requirement. | ||
SECTION 4. Subchapter C, Chapter 791, Government Code, is | ||
amended by adding Section 791.037 to read as follows: | ||
Sec. 791.037. SOLID WASTE DISPOSAL SERVICES IN CERTAIN | ||
COUNTIES. (a) In this section, "solid waste" has the meaning | ||
assigned by Section 361.003, Health and Safety Code. | ||
(b) This section applies only to a county with a population | ||
of more than 1.5 million in which more than 75 percent of the | ||
population resides in a single municipality. | ||
(c) A county may contract with a municipality to provide, | ||
directly or through a contract with another entity, a mandatory | ||
program under Section 364.034, Health and Safety Code, for solid | ||
waste disposal services in an area of the county located within the | ||
extraterritorial jurisdiction of the municipality if the | ||
municipality does not provide solid waste disposal services in that | ||
area. | ||
(d) A contract under this section must include provisions | ||
regarding the termination of the county's provision of service on | ||
the occurrence of certain contingencies, including the annexation | ||
of the area covered by the contract by the municipality or the | ||
provision of service to the area by the municipality. | ||
SECTION 5. This Act takes effect immediately if it receives | ||
a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as | ||
prov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this | ||
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this | ||
Act takes effect September 1, 2017. |
